Comprehending the Sorts Of Surety Agreement Bonds



To totally understand the types of surety agreement bonds, professionals have to familiarize themselves with the various options offered.

There are three main kinds of guaranty agreement bonds that contractors must be aware of: proposal bonds, performance bonds, and repayment bonds.

Bid bonds are usually needed when a contractor is sending a bid for a building task. This bond ensures that if the service provider is awarded the project, they'll become part of a contract and provide the required performance and settlement bonds.

Efficiency bonds assure that the contractor will certainly finish the task according to the regards to the agreement.

Payment bonds shield subcontractors and suppliers by making sure that they'll be paid for their deal with the task.

Tips to Get Surety Agreement Bonds



To acquire guaranty agreement bonds, service providers need to follow a collection of actions to guarantee their eligibility and protect the needed bonding.

The initial step is to analyze your monetary standing. Read the Full Document will examine your economic security, credit history, and previous job experience to establish if you meet their underwriting requirements.

The second action is to pick a reputable guaranty bond carrier. Research study various suppliers, compare their prices, and consider their know-how in the building market.

When you have actually picked a carrier, you'll require to finish an application form and submit it with the required sustaining documents. These files may consist of financial declarations, work experience records, and referrals.

After examining your application, the guaranty bond service provider will certainly identify your bond quantity and release the bond if you're approved.



It is essential to begin this procedure early to guarantee you have the needed bonding in place before beginning any kind of building and construction projects.
